The biography explores Elizabeth Gaskell's life, highlighting her early loss of her mother and her upbringing in Knutsford, which inspired her novel Cranford. After marrying and moving to Manchester, she became friends with notable authors like Charlotte Bronte and Charles Dickens, who recognized her talent. Gaskell's writing reflects the complexities of Victorian industrial society, infused with her moral and religious perspectives, allowing her to capture the diverse experiences of different social classes.
